Centos8安装vsftpd连接不了,用ftp命令也无法登录?

阿里云ECS服务器Centos 8系统下,安装vsftpd后用flashfxp连接不了,在服务器端用ftp命令也无法登录,应该如何解决呢?

能搜索到这里,应该vsftpd基本的安装配置都不会有问题,赫琴在这里给各位罗列了几个容易被忽略的要点,希望能解决您的问题。

一、阿里云服务器vsftpd出现连接问题,应该先去阿里云ECS后台,找到安全规则,在里面开放一个21/21端口。因为阿里云新的服务器都没有开放这个端口,如果你没有先解决这个问题,后面所有的操作都是徒劳。

二、阿里云服务器默认都没有开启防火墙,不需要在firewall服务和SELinux上面浪费时间研究。

三、用ftp命令,出现此错误提示:-bash: ftp: command not found,是ftp命令没有安装,可通过yum方式安装ftp命令:yum -y install ftp。

四、通过ftp命令登录,如果出现ftp vsftpd 530 login incorrect错误,可以尝试从下面这两个地方来解决:

1、检查/etc/pam.d/vsftpd,注释掉:#auth required pam_shells.so

2、ftp登陆用户的密码错误,建议重新设置密码。(文/赫琴,禁止转载。)

阿里云服务器复工促销中,点击领取大额优惠券。

赞 (0) 评论 分享 ()